WebCandy Montgomery appeared at her trial in a white knit sweater, hair short and wispy around her head, large-frame glasses, every inch a suburban mother, and her attorney’s defense strategy was bold: not guilty by way of self-defense. Under hypnotism performed by a Houston psychiatrist, Dr. Fred Fason, Candy recalled the day of the murder.
